On-Site Effluent Treatment Regional Plan
The Operative On-Site Effluent Treatment Regional Plan 2006 (amended to incorporate Plan Change 1) deals with the effects on water quality from the discharge of domestic wastewater in the Bay of Plenty.

Plan Change 1
Plan Change 1 (Date Deferral for Small Communities) was made operative at the Strategy, Policy and Planning Committee meeting on 8 February 2011, and incorporated into the On-Site Effluent Treatment Regional Plan on 1 March 2011.
Plan Change 1 defers the dates on which conventional septic tank systems require consent for the Rotorua Lakes and Western Bay of Plenty maintenance zone communities and those conventional and advanced systems in Rotorua areas (including Mamaku) that have nitrogen reduction requirements.
